Oswald (Os) Kienapfel VE7OK

On Tuesday, January 6, 2026, Os unexpectedly died at the age of 71. As member number 51, he had been a longtime member of the club.

Os led the weekly “20 Below Morse Code Club” every Sunday at 19:00 and attended the majority of the club’s meetings. He was involved in the Point Roberts club’s emergency program and had a keen interest in emergency preparedness. Os usually set up and ran the 80m/10m station and was an invaluable asset on the annual field day.

At the beginning of the club’s gathering on Thursday, January 8, 2026, members paid tribute to him by calling him three times on the club repeater in the customary manner. The chairman declared “Victor echo seven oscar kilo – silent key” after receiving no response.

Members reflected on what they remembered about Os. Many were taken aback by the unexpected news. Most people remember him for having a good sense of humour and being fun. He was frequently silly and didn’t take life too seriously. He thought in an unconventional way, and his club presentations were unique. Os was often the first person new members spoke to at the club, and they found him to be warm, inviting, and kind.

The membership valued him and will miss him greatly.
